1080×1920, H.264, 9:16 vertical. Subtitles burned into the caption bar, never over the footage.
Taken from a teardown of Perspective’s Meta ads — their competitor ads have run continuously for over a year, which is the only proof that matters.
| Rule | Why |
|---|---|
| Cut every 1.5–3 seconds | Their winning ads never hold a frame longer. Not a zoom for the sake of it — a new piece of information each time. |
| Every visual is literal | They use a turtle for slow loading, cartoon spies for hidden problems, a man holding a “QUICK MATHS” sign. Show the thing he is saying, never a mood. |
| The number moves while he talks | Don’t show a static figure. Change it on camera — 3× ticking to 4.5× is worth more than any explanation. |
| One styled word per beat | In the caption bar, one word per section gets colour or italic. That’s the retention device — the eye keeps re-engaging. |
| Text lives in bars, never over footage | Nothing important is ever covered. On the board half this matters most, because the numbers are the point. |
| Screen recording carries ~40% | Of their best ad’s runtime. Ours should be more — the board is the differentiator. |
Decorative movement. A zoom that doesn’t correspond to what’s being said reads as filler and people leave. If a line names no card on the board, the B-Roll column says so — stay on Moran’s face and keep it simple. That is always better than cutting to something irrelevant.
